Analysis
The most recent figure for indicators on health and safety at work in Italy is 69, measured in 2006. That is the lowest value across all 13 years on record.
That represents a change of down 2.8% on the previous year and down 32.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, indicators on health and safety at work in Italy peaked at 113 in 1994 and was at its lowest, 69, in 2006.
That places Italy 23rd out of 30 countries with data for 2006,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 13 years of available data.
Indicators on health and safety at work in Italy,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1994 | 113 | — |
| 1995 | 102 | -9.7% |
| 1996 | 102 | +0.0% |
| 1997 | 100 | -2.0% |
| 1998 | 100 | +0.0% |
| 1999 | 99 | -1.0% |
| 2000 | 99 | +0.0% |
| 2001 | 92 | -7.1% |
| 2002 | 83 | -9.8% |
| 2003 | 80 | -3.6% |
| 2004 | 75 | -6.2% |
| 2005 | 71 | -5.3% |
| 2006 | 69 | -2.8% |
